In this paper, we introduce concepts in control theory to provide fundamental mechanisms for sustainable and predictable performance in real-time computer graphics software. The objective is to provide a comprehensive foundation in distilling and adapting control principles for real-time rendering so that new classes of such powerful software may be conceived and developed. |
